分享

这几个函数帮你提高对数组的理解,掌握只需一分钟!

 EXCEL应用之家 2021-10-31


送人玫瑰,手有余香,请将文章分享给更多朋友

动手操作是熟练掌握EXCEL的最快捷途径!



小伙伴们啊,大家都知道数组是写在花括号{}中的,例如{1,2,3},或者{"A","B","C"},通常是要手工输入,或者由公式的计算结果而生成内存数组的。

有时候会有这样的疑问,花括号中的数字或文本能否引用公式的计算结果?比如说,下图中单元格A2:A3中存放有数据,现在要分别用“1”和它们各自的文本长度生成一个数组。



可以确定的是,公式是不能直接写在花括号中的,那样也不会生成我们需要的结果。

思考十秒钟......


01

利用IF函数可以实现此目的。



选中单元格E1:F1,输入公式“=IF({1,0},1,LEN(A2))”,三键回车即可。

IF函数的第一个参数也是一个常量数组,它的含义是,当等于1是,公式返回的结果是“1”,当等于0时,公式返回的结果是LEN(A2)计算的结果。


02

通过CHOOSE函数也可以达到此目的。



原理和IF函数那个公式是一样的。只不过,这里使用CHOOSE函数指定第一个和第二个参数,并返回其值。


03

这里还有一个更巧妙的方法介绍给大家。



公式非常简洁,但其思路却非常奇妙,小伙伴们可以细细品味其中的奥妙!


好了朋友们,今天和大家分享的内容就是这些了!喜欢我的文章请分享、转发、点赞和收藏吧!如有任何问题可以随时私信我哦!

-END-

长按下方二维码关注EXCEL应用之家

面对EXCEL操作问题时不再迷茫无助

我就知道你“在看”


推荐阅读

    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多